MySQL to Render Postgres

This is an operator’s playbook for a MySQL to Render Postgres migration. It covers the Render-specific connection details — external vs internal URLs, required TLS, and the inbound IP allowlist — that you need to move MySQL into a Render PostgreSQL instance.

If you searched for how to migrate MySQL to Render Postgres or move a MySQL database to Render, the short version is: connect from an external host with Render’s External Database URL and sslmode=require, allow your migration host in the inbound IP rules, never load production data into a Free instance, and let pgferry’s MySQL type mapping handle enums, sets, and unsigned integers.

Use this guide when you have a live MySQL database and want it on a Render-hosted PostgreSQL instance. It assumes you have created a Render Postgres instance. For source-side behavior that is not Render-specific, read the generic MySQL to PostgreSQL guide alongside this page.

  • A Render Postgres instance. Render auto-generates the database name and user at creation, and these are immutable afterward — read them from the instance’s Connect menu.
  • Do not use a Free instance for production data. Free Postgres instances expire 30 days after creation and are capped at 1 GB with no backups. Use a paid instance type sized for your dataset.
  • Render’s role is not a superuser but owns its database — it can CREATE SCHEMA, create tables/indexes/FKs/sequences, and CREATE EXTENSION for Render’s allow-listed extensions. That covers everything pgferry needs.

Render gives every instance two URLs:

URLHost shapeUse from
External Database URLdpg-<id>-a.<region>-postgres.render.com:5432An external migration host
Internal Database URLdpg-<id>-a (private)A Render service in the same region
  • From your laptop or any external host, use the External Database URL. Only a service running inside Render (same region) can use the internal host.
  • TLS is required for external connections. Append ?sslmode=require. Render manages the certificate; sslmode=require encrypts in transit (it does not validate the chain, which is the documented/safe setting).
  • Inbound IP allowlist: by default a Render Postgres instance is reachable from any IP (0.0.0.0/0), gated only by credentials + SSL. If you have tightened the inbound rules, add your migration host’s IP (e.g. 203.0.113.45/32) on the instance’s Networking section before starting. If a dynamic IP makes that impractical, temporarily widen the rule for the load and tighten it afterward. The allowlist applies only to the external URL — internal connections are always allowed.
  • Connection limits scale with instance RAM (100 connections below 8 GB, 200 at 8–16 GB, and up). Keep pgferry’s workers/index_workers within the instance’s ceiling.

Example external target DSN:

Terminal window
export PGFERRY_TARGET_DSN='postgres://<user>:<password>@dpg-<id>-a.<region>-postgres.render.com:5432/<dbname>?sslmode=require'
export PGFERRY_SOURCE_DSN='user:pass@tcp(mysql-host:3306)/source_db'

Step-by-step MySQL to Render Postgres migration flow

Section titled “Step-by-step MySQL to Render Postgres migration flow”
  1. Create a paid Render Postgres instance sized for the dataset; copy the External Database URL.
  2. Add your migration host’s IP to the inbound rules if you have restricted them; enable storage autoscaling or pre-provision storage.
  3. Generate a config with pgferry wizard or start from the snippet above.
  4. Export PGFERRY_SOURCE_DSN and PGFERRY_TARGET_DSN.
  5. Run pgferry plan migration.toml and resolve every warning.
  6. Run pgferry migrate migration.toml; rerun on interruption (resume = true).
  7. Recreate views, routines, and triggers via hooks.
  • pgferry validate migration.toml re-runs validation without redoing DDL or COPY.
  • Confirm required extensions are enabled (CREATE EXTENSION for anything plan flagged).
  • Always load into the primary, never a read replica.
  • Tighten the inbound IP allowlist after the load if you widened it.

SymptomCauseFix
Connection times out from your hostInbound IP not allow-listedAdd your IP to the instance’s inbound rules
no encryption / SSL requiredMissing TLSAppend ?sslmode=require
Can’t resolve the dpg-...-a hostUsed the internal URL externallyUse the External Database URL
Data gone after a monthLoaded into a Free instanceUse a paid instance for production
too many connectionsworkers above the instance limitLower workers/index_workers or size up
